Efficient Components for Lower-Waste Lighting Programs

Better lighting sustainability begins before a fixture ships. Correct driver selection, compatible controls, emergency planning, and long-term replacement logic reduce avoidable returns, unnecessary site visits, and premature component changes.

Our commitment is practical: help projects specify fewer wrong parts.

Samsung LED treats sustainability as an engineering and procurement discipline. A component package that matches the fixture, control protocol, emergency requirement, and compliance context is less likely to be replaced, reworked, or over-ordered. The most useful environmental action for many B2B lighting projects is a cleaner specification at the start, and Samsung's mid-power LM301 series and high-power LH351 emitters publish full LM-80 lumen-maintenance data and TM-21 projected L90 figures so luminaire designers can build for ten-year service life rather than three-year warranty replacement cycles.

Control energy intelligently

Samsung mid-power packages reach 220 lm/W efficacy at 65 mA drive, letting fixture OEMs hit DLC Premium with smaller heat sinks, fewer LEDs per board, and lower copper-content drivers — measurable kWh savings begin at the bill of materials, not just the dimming schedule.

Reduce replacement waste

Published binning tolerances (3-step MacAdam ellipse), TM-30 Rf/Rg colour metrics, and IES TM-21 lifetime projections give specifiers the documentation they need to source identical replacement LEDs five years post-installation, avoiding mismatched fixtures and full-zone re-lamping.

Support compliant materials

Samsung LED components ship with REACH, RoHS 3, and Prop 65 disclosure files, low-halogen flame-retardant housings, and recyclable kraft packaging — so lighting OEMs can publish EPDs, claim LEED MR Building Product credits, and pass European CSRD scope-3 audits on the same component dossier.
